A lot of Kossacks are now treating this election as done deal. While I agree things seem to have swung Obama's way, and the DKos poll still shows a double-digit lead, there are some other polls that are a bit more sobering.
To wit:
Hotline
Obama/Biden 45%
McCain/Palin 44%
Undec 9%
Battleground
Obama/Biden 49%
McCain/Palin 45%
Undec 6%
NYTimes/CBS
Obama/Biden 47%
McCain/Palin 43%
Undec 7%
I realize all these polls were taken before the debate last night, but I'm not expecting a big bounce for Obama since he mainly just held his serve.
The thing scaring me is the undecideds. In the primaries, they seemed to break overwhelmingly to Hillary. Truly undecided people at this point are probably looking for any reason they can to vote against Obama.
Again, I do not want to be alarmist, but just remind us that there is a long way to go and a lot of work to do still.
